Guidewire Set to Report Q3 Earnings: Here's What Investors Should Know
ZACKS· 2025-06-02 14:01
Core Insights - Guidewire Software, Inc (GWRE) is expected to report third-quarter fiscal 2025 results, with management projecting revenues between $283 million and $289 million, and a Zacks Consensus Estimate of $285.7 million, reflecting an 18.7% year-over-year increase [1][3] - The consensus estimate for earnings per share is 46 cents, unchanged over the past 60 days, compared to 26 cents per share in the same quarter last year [1][3] Revenue and Earnings Expectations - GWRE anticipates subscription and support revenues of $178 million and services revenues of $52 million, with modest sequential growth in subscription revenues due to three fewer calendar days in the quarter [5][7] - Non-GAAP operating income is projected to be between $36 million and $42 million, with subscription gross margin expected to be 68-69% [7][8] Market Performance and Growth Drivers - GWRE has experienced a trailing four-quarter earnings surprise of 40.2% on average, and its shares have increased by 96.1% over the past year, outperforming the Internet-Software industry's growth of 35% [3][4] - The company's performance is likely supported by strong demand for cloud-based solutions and a robust deal volume, particularly among Tier 1 insurers, as well as increasing international momentum in regions like Asia Pacific and Europe [3][4][6] Annual Recurring Revenue (ARR) and Margins - For Q3 fiscal 2025, ARR is expected to be between $942 million and $947 million, with an estimate of $944.6 million [8] - The non-GAAP gross margin for subscription and support is anticipated to be 68.7%, with operating income estimated at $39 million, representing an 87.8% year-over-year increase [9] Challenges and Considerations - The company faces challenges from increasing investments in product enhancements and potential impacts from global macroeconomic conditions and inflation, which may affect license revenues due to the migration of on-premise customers to the cloud [9][10]

Wolters Kluwer First-Quarter 2025 Trading Update
Globenewswire· 2025-05-07 06:00
Core Insights - Wolters Kluwer reported a solid start to 2025 with sustained growth in recurring revenues and margin improvement, reaffirming full-year guidance [4][8][17] Financial Performance - First-quarter revenues increased by 8% in reporting currencies, with organic growth of 5% compared to 6% in 1Q 2024 [5] - Recurring revenues, which constitute 83% of total revenues, grew by 7% organically, consistent with the previous year [5] - Non-recurring revenues declined by 2% organically, with notable growth in Financial & Corporate Compliance and Legal & Regulatory transactional revenues [5][9][10] - Adjusted operating profit increased by 11% at constant currencies, while adjusted free cash flow rose by 5% [8] Segment Performance - Health revenues grew by 3% in constant currencies and 4% organically, with Clinical Solutions achieving 5% organic growth [6] - Tax & Accounting revenues increased by 8% in constant currencies and 5% organically, with cloud software subscriptions growing by 19% [7] - Corporate Performance & ESG revenues saw a 10% increase in constant currencies and organically, driven by strong growth in EHS & ESG solutions [11] Cash Flow and Debt - Cash conversion improved modestly, with adjusted free cash flow increasing by 5% in constant currencies [12] - Net debt stood at €3,347 million as of March 31, 2025, with a net-debt-to-EBITDA ratio of 1.7x [13] Shareholder Returns - The company completed €286 million of its planned €1 billion share buyback program as of May 5, 2025 [8][14] - A proposed total dividend of €2.33 for financial year 2024 represents a 12% increase compared to the previous year [15] Guidance and Outlook - Full-year 2025 guidance remains unchanged, with expectations for organic growth in line with prior year [17][21][22] - Adjusted operating profit margin is anticipated to improve, particularly in Health and Corporate Performance & ESG [17]
